OSCE mediators, Russian official discuss Karabakh conflict

The OSCE Minsk Group co-chairs have discussed the Karabakh conflict with Russia's deputy foreign minister, Grigoriy Karasin.

Karasin held working consultations yesterday in Moscow with OSCE Minsk Group co-chairs Bernard Fassier (France), Robert Bradtke (USA) and Igor Popov (Russia), and Andrzej Kasprzyk, personal representative of the OSCE chairman-in-office.

They discussed pressing issues related to the Armenian-Azerbaijani conflict over Nagorno-Karabakh, 1 news.az reported.

At the weekend, the Armenian and Azerbaijani foreign ministers met in Almaty with the heads of the delegations of the countries co-chairing the Minsk Group mediators. In a downbeat statement after the talks, the mediators said "the efforts made so far by the parties to the conflict have not been sufficient to overcome their differences", and urged for a greater spirit of compromise on both sides.

On the instructions of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ov, Karasin presented the "For contribution to international cooperation" to French co-chair Bernard Fassier.
